Blackstone is making a bet on something new: high-precision actuators.
What’s happening:
- Blackstone (NYSE: BX) has agreed to make a strategic equity investment into South Korean high-precision actuator supplier Futronic
Why it matters:
- Futronic is a global producer of high-precision actuators that are used in both automotive manufacturing and humanoid robots
Going deeper:
- Futronic has been operating for more than three decades and has publicly stated they have existing contracts with some of the largest car manufacturers in the world
- This is widely considered to be Blackstone’s first major investment into high-precision actuators and robotics hardware
The fine print:
- The exact financial terms of Blackstone’s investment into Futronic have not yet been publicly disclosed
